人工智能(AI)基礎軟件開發(fā)是構建和優(yōu)化支撐人工智能技術應用的核心框架、庫和工具的過程。它不僅涉及算法實現(xiàn),還包括模型訓練、推理部署和系統(tǒng)優(yōu)化,是現(xiàn)代AI生態(tài)系統(tǒng)不可或缺的組成部分。
基礎軟件開發(fā)通常從核心算法庫開始,例如TensorFlow、PyTorch或Scikit-learn,這些工具提供了豐富的API用于數(shù)據(jù)預處理、模型構建和訓練。開發(fā)者需要精通機器學習原理、編程語言(如Python或C++)以及并行計算技術,以高效處理大規(guī)模數(shù)據(jù)。軟件必須支持多平臺部署,從云端服務器到邊緣設備,確保模型能在不同環(huán)境中穩(wěn)定運行。
面臨的挑戰(zhàn)包括計算資源管理、模型可解釋性以及數(shù)據(jù)安全和隱私保護。隨著AI技術的普及,開源社區(qū)在推動基礎軟件開發(fā)中發(fā)揮了關鍵作用,通過協(xié)作加速創(chuàng)新。
基礎軟件將更加注重自動化(如AutoML)、可擴展性和跨領域集成,助力AI在醫(yī)療、金融和制造業(yè)等行業(yè)的廣泛應用。開發(fā)人員應持續(xù)學習,跟上技術進步,以構建更智能、高效的解決方案。
如若轉載,請注明出處:http://www.sybcj.cn/product/6.html
更新時間:2026-01-12 17:29:23